When to Pave Asphalt in St. Louis and the Metro East

Around St. Louis, the hot-mix paving season usually runs from about April into mid-November, with the most margin from May through early October. Here is why temperature, rain and ground conditions set those limits, and how to plan your project around them.

The short answer for St. Louis

Around St. Louis, the practical season for hot-mix asphalt usually runs from about April into mid-November. The most dependable stretch is May through early October, when days are warm, nights stay well above freezing and the ground has dried out from winter. Paving at the edges of that window can work on the right day, with less margin for error.

The weather record explains why. NOAA's 1991 to 2020 climate normals for St. Louis Lambert International Airport show an average high of 68.0°F in April, 77.1°F in May and 81.1°F in September, falling to 69.2°F in October and 55.5°F in November. Even around November 15, the normal daily high is still about 56°F. January averages a high of just 40.4°F and a low of 23.8°F. Outlying towns and low river-valley spots can run a few degrees colder on clear, calm nights, so treat these numbers as a guide.

Why temperature matters: the compaction window

Hot mix is stone, sand and liquid asphalt binder, heated at the plant and hauled to your job hot. Rolling squeezes out air and locks the stone together, and that density keeps water out and the surface from raveling. Once the mix cools past a certain point it gets too stiff, and more rolling does little good. Pavement Interactive puts that cutoff at about 175°F for dense-graded hot mix. The minutes between laydown and that temperature are the compaction window.

That window depends on layer thickness, mix temperature, air temperature, wind, sun and the temperature of the base underneath. The base is the one people forget: cold ground pulls heat out of the bottom of the mat while cool air and wind pull it from the top. Minnesota DOT offers a tool called PaveCool that was built for exactly this problem. It estimates how long a lift takes to cool from its delivery temperature to 175°F.

Modeled examples show how tight it gets. In sample MultiCool runs published by Pavement Interactive (a clear 10 a.m. start, a 10 mph wind, and air and base at the same temperature), a 2-inch lift delivered at 250°F had about 16 minutes to reach 175°F at 60°F, and about 12 minutes at 25°F. A 4.2-inch lift at the same mix temperature had about 39 to 54 minutes. A 1-inch lift had only 7 to 9 minutes, even delivered hotter at 300°F. Driveway and parking lot surface layers sit at the thin end, so a cold, windy, cloudy day hits them hardest.

What MoDOT and IDOT require

State highway specifications are a useful floor. MoDOT's standard specifications for asphalt pavement (Section 403) say no mix goes down on a wet or frozen surface, or when the air or the surface being paved is below 40°F.

MoDOT is stricter about chip seal, which its specifications call a seal coat: air and pavement must both be above 60°F, and none goes down when the National Weather Service forecast calls for temperatures below 40°F within 24 hours.

On the Illinois side, IDOT's inspector checklist for hot-mix binder and surface courses asks for an air temperature in the shade of at least 40°F and rising for binder courses and 45°F and rising for surface courses.

These are minimums written for highway projects with inspectors on site. A thin driveway surface on a cold morning has less room for error, so it makes sense to build in more cushion: a forecast in the 50s or warmer and rising, a dry base and light wind.

How hot-mix plants run through the year

Contractors buy hot mix from asphalt plants, and in regions with real winters, plants typically slow down or shut down for the coldest months. Tennessee DOT, for example, says asphalt plants there are closed during the winter months and hot asphalt is not available until spring, so its crews typically patch potholes with cold mix in the meantime.

Plan around the same general pattern here. With a January normal high of 40.4°F and state specs that stop paving below 40°F, midwinter hot-mix work rarely makes sense. Plants typically ramp up as spring road work starts. Exact dates vary by plant and by year, and a mild spell can extend the season on either end.

Cold patch is a stopgap for potholes until hot mix is available again. TDOT notes cold mix is not always as durable, and that patching material does not stick as well when conditions are cold or wet.

Rain, wet ground and the base under your asphalt

Temperature is only half of it. Hot mix should not go on a wet surface, and a soaked base will not compact the way it should. Spring is the wettest stretch of the year here. At Lambert, May averages 4.82 inches of rain and April 4.73 inches, and May sees measurable rain on about 13 days. September is the driest month of the paving season at 2.96 inches, with measurable rain on about 7 days, the fewest of any month.

Your asphalt is only as good as the base under it. After heavy rain, base rock and the soil beneath it, clay especially, can stay soft for days. A careful crew checks for soft spots first, often by running a loaded truck over the base and watching for movement. Waiting a couple of dry days costs far less than paving over a wet spot that settles next spring.

  • Wait if water is standing on the base or the old pavement.
  • Wait if base rock ruts or pumps under a loaded truck.
  • Wait if rain is forecast during laydown and rolling.
  • Wait if there is frost, or the air or surface is below 40°F.

Month by month around St. Louis

How the year typically plays out, using NOAA's 1991 to 2020 normals for Lambert:

  • December to February: normal highs of about 40 to 46°F and roughly 19 to 24 freezing nights a month. A good time for estimates and planning.
  • March: normal highs near 57°F, lows near 37°F and about 10 freezing nights. The ground is often cold and wet, so thin surface paving is a gamble.
  • April: normal highs near 68°F. The median last spring freeze is about April 2, and in about 1 year in 10 the last freeze comes on or after April 17. Paving picks up on dry, mild stretches.
  • May and June: normal highs near 77 and 86°F. Good paving temperatures, but May is the wettest month of the year (4.82 inches), so expect some rain delays.
  • July and August: normal highs near 90 and 88°F, with about 16 and 13 days of 90°F or hotter. Long compaction windows.
  • September and October: normal highs near 81 and 69°F, and September has the fewest rainy days of the year. Often the best paving weather, so fall calendars tend to fill.
  • November: normal highs near 56°F and lows near 37°F. The median first fall freeze is about November 4, with a 1 in 10 chance of one by October 23 and a 9 in 10 chance by November 18. Thin surface work gets riskier each week.

Paving in summer heat, and caring for new asphalt

Heat is not a reason to avoid paving. It gives the crew a long compaction window. The tradeoff is that fresh asphalt stays soft longer. MoDOT's specifications keep traffic off new asphalt until the surface cools to 140°F or below, and a dark surface in July sun can take a while to get there.

For a new driveway, keep cars off for typically about 3 days, longer in a heat wave, and keep heavy trucks off longer still. Turn the wheel only while the car is rolling. Through the first summer, set plywood under kickstands, trailer jacks and dumpster rails. Sealcoat comes later: new asphalt usually cures for months, not days, before it is sealed.

Planning and booking: work backward from your date

Paving schedules are usually set weeks ahead, so plan backward from your date. For spring or early summer paving, get estimates in late winter, around February or March. For fall paving, call by mid to late summer. The estimate visit should cover drainage, the base, truck access and how the new surface meets your garage and the street.

Some cities and counties require a permit for a driveway approach or work in the public right-of-way, and rules vary by town, so check early. HOA approval can add weeks. For a parking lot, phase the work around business hours and plan the restriping. ADA.gov says a business or state or local government that restripes a parking lot must provide accessible spaces as required by the 2010 ADA Standards, with the count figured separately for each parking facility, not for the whole site.

Chip seal and sealcoat need the warmest weather of all. MoDOT requires air and pavement above 60°F for chip seal, and sealcoat products typically call for dry pavement and at least 50°F and rising (check the label). Schedule those for late spring through early fall.

Questions

Can you pave asphalt in the winter in St. Louis?

Rarely with hot mix. January averages a high of 40.4°F at Lambert, MoDOT's highway specs do not allow asphalt paving when the air or surface is below 40°F, and asphalt plants in cold-winter regions typically slow down or close for the coldest months. Winter is for estimates and planning, and potholes get a temporary cold patch until spring.

Is spring or fall better for paving a driveway in St. Louis?

Both work. Spring gives new asphalt a full warm season before its first winter, but April and May are the two wettest months at Lambert. September into mid-October usually brings drier ground and mild temperatures, and the median first freeze is about November 4. Either way, book early.

How long after rain can asphalt be laid?

The surface has to be dry, with no standing water, and the base has to be firm. After a light shower, paving can often resume once things dry out. After days of soaking rain, a clay subgrade can stay soft for several days, so a careful crew checks it before paving.
